Foundations and applications of financial technologies
BFX3370
Synopsis
In this comprehensive undergraduate unit, you will gain a foundational understanding of the dynamic synergy between finance and technology. Throughout this structured curriculum, you will explore the fundamental components of the financial system, delve into the evolution of fintech, and actively apply your knowledge through hands-on experiences related to blockchain, AI, and machine learning. These practical exercises and case studies will prepare you for future study or future career in the field of financial technology.
